Methods: Thirty-four healthy resistance-trained men were randomly assigned to one of three experimental groups: a low-volume group performing one set per exercise per training session (n = 11), a …The adductor group of thigh muscles occupies the medial myofascial compartment of the thigh. This group of muscles, in general, takes origin from the pelvis and inserts on the femur. As is often the case, exceptions exist to the compartment generalizations; the gracilis, rather than attaching to the femur, attaches to the proximal …

Article ll.Muscle cramps result in continuous, involuntary, painful, and localized contraction of an entire muscle group, individual single muscle, or select muscle fibers. Generally, the cramp can last from minutes to a few seconds for idiopathic or known causes with healthy subjects or in the presence of diseases.
